Technology as a Growth Enabler
Small businesses often face challenges such as limited resources, smaller budgets, and less manpower compared to large corporations. However, technology levels the playing field. From communication platforms to digital payment systems, technology provides affordable solutions that allow small enterprises to expand their reach.
Key benefits include:
- Wider customer reach through online platforms.
- Better communication with global clients and partners.
- Improved efficiency with automation and digital tools.
- Cost savings by reducing physical infrastructure needs.

Boosting Efficiency with Automation
Automation allows small businesses to handle tasks such as inventory tracking, billing, and customer service more effectively. By saving time on routine work, business owners can focus on innovation, strategy, and customer engagement. This balance is critical for competing in global markets.
Data-Driven Decision Making
Technology provides access to data that helps businesses understand customer needs, buying behavior, and market trends. With these insights, small businesses can adjust their strategies quickly and make smarter decisions. This agility allows them to respond faster than many larger competitors.
Building Customer Trust
Trust is essential for success in any market. Secure payment systems, transparent online interactions, and reliable digital communication help small businesses build credibility. When customers feel safe and valued, they are more likely to return and recommend the business to others.
